Output 2a3bf667af97ca5c73c407d22ae8f08ed8fb97cd3cb8aecd1e104e5b4998bb2e:0

value
2943260463
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0cc7cb5d13ebaa3f588de35afec847b186df7f87 OP_EQUALVERIFY OP_CHECKSIG
address
12AaTG3th4RQqpTc1BcPiscgsQRVUmhzyR
transaction
2a3bf667af97ca5c73c407d22ae8f08ed8fb97cd3cb8aecd1e104e5b4998bb2e
confirmations
435646
spent
true